Inclusion Criteria
1 The Patients presenting sign and symptoms of
Krimigranthi with Itching of eyelids Burning sensation Lacrimation and white scales along the base of eyelashes
2 Between the age group 18 to 60 years
Exclusion Criteria
1 Blepharitis associated with conjunctivitis and
Ulcerative Blepharitis
2 Patients suffering from Ptosis Psoriasis Drug induced Blepharitis
